Cooking Steps

Cook the garlic rice
1

• Finely chop garlic. • In a medium saucepan, heat the butter with a drizzle of olive oil over medium heat. Cook 1/2 the garlic until fragrant, 1-2 minutes. • Add the basmati rice, the water and vegetable stock powder, stir, then bring to the boil. • Reduce the heat to low and cover with a lid. Cook for 10 minutes, then remove from the heat and keep covered until rice is tender and water is absorbed, 10 minutes.

TIP: The rice will finish cooking in its own steam so don't peek!

Make the garlic yoghurt
2

• While the rice is cooking, heat a large frying pan over medium-high heat with a drizzle of olive oil. Cook remaining garlic until fragrant, 1 minute. • Transfer garlic oil to a small bowl, then add Greek-style yoghurt and stir to combine. Season to taste.

Cook the chicken
3

• Place your hand flat on top of chicken breast and slice through horizontally to make two thin steaks. • In a medium bowl, combine chicken, Middle Eastern seasoning, a drizzle of olive oil and a pinch of salt. • Wash and dry the frying pan, then return to medium-high heat with a drizzle of olive oil. Cook chicken until cooked through, 3-5 minutes each side. • Remove pan from heat, then add the honey, turning chicken to coat.

Prep the salsa
4

• While the chicken is cooking, finely chop tomato and cucumber.

Make the salsa
5

• In a second medium bowl, combine a drizzle of white wine vinegar and olive oil with a pinch of salt and pepper. • Add cucumber and tomato and stir to combine.

Serve up
6

• Slice Middle Eastern chicken. • Divide garlic rice between bowls. Top with chicken and cucumber salsa. • Drizzle over garlic yoghurt and tear over parsley to serve. Enjoy!
